On location coverage of the annual MacWorld expo in Boston. Guests include Jean Louis Gassee and Bob Metcalfe. Companies profiled include Aba Software, Cricket Software, Deneba Software, Microillusions, Silicon Beach, Advent, Claris, Dynaware, Pixelogic, Aldus, Letraset, Microsoft, Ashton-Tate, Springboard Software, Aegis, MacroMind, TrueVision, Electronic Arts, SuperMac, and Apple. Originally broadcast in 1988.

Business software-o-rama
This episode scans through a lot of business software from old school mac companies like Cricket, Silicon Beach Software and Macromedia.
The then-new desktop publishing sector gets the most attention, and it's interesting to see how much variety there was in paint- and layout software at the time. Most demoed professional apps are strikingly slow though.
Oh, and there's some hilarious late-80s fashion in there. Random access also features a piece on the upcoming NeXT computer.
